In the beautiful coastal city of Corona del Mar, a stunning home has just sold for a whopping $20 million, making a big splash in Orange County’s real estate market. This lovely property, perched at 1615 Bayadere Terrace, offers an impressive 5,741 square feet of living space and sits on a generous 0.44-acre lot. It’s not just any house; it was built in 1958 and has been updated with modern amenities fit for a luxurious lifestyle.
The layout features four spacious bedrooms and 4.5 bathrooms, providing ample room for families or guests. The interior is packed with features that today’s buyers dream about, including a cozy dry bar for entertaining, a home gym to stay fit, and an outdoor grill area perfect for summer barbecues. A sparkling pool invites you to take a dip, and for car enthusiasts, there’s a three-car garage.
One of the standout features of this property is the gorgeous ocean view. Just imagine waking up to the soothing sound of waves and breathtaking sunrises every day! Plus, the location is convenient for golf lovers due to its proximity to a nearby golf course. Talk about a slice of paradise!
Bayadere Terrace is one of the most coveted streets in Corona del Mar, and with such a prime location, it’s easy to see why properties here are in high demand. In fact, recent sales in the area include an impressive six-bedroom, nine-bathroom estate that went for a record-setting $26 million! It’s clear that the luxury market is alive and thriving.
